Warehouse cleaning services in Cincinnati, OH are a safety line item first

A warehouse floor is not a cosmetic problem. It is a slip claim, a failed audit, or a forklift skidding on a patch nobody swept. Dust is the other half: fine product and concrete dust settles on racking, light fittings and sprinkler heads, and it does not stay there — it drops back onto whatever is below it every time a door opens.

So an industrial cleaning contract is really a schedule, not a service. Daily sweeping in forklift lanes, periodic machine scrubbing on the slab, high-bay cleaning on a rotation, and dock areas done often enough that they never become the reason a trailer sits waiting.

Scheduling warehouse cleaning services in Cincinnati, OH

Daily, around the shift pattern

Forklift area cleaning, aisle sweeping, breakroom cleaning and warehouse restroom cleaning every day, slotted into the gap between shifts rather than working alongside moving equipment.

Weekly plus periodic scrub

Suits steadier operations. Welfare areas and offices weekly, with ride-on industrial floor scrubbing across the open slab on a monthly or quarterly cycle.

Shutdown and high-bay

The work that needs the building quiet: racking cleaning, high-bay cleaning of beams, light fittings and duct runs, and a full slab scrub. Booked around planned shutdowns or holiday weeks.

What warehouse cleaning services in Cincinnati, OH cost

Industrial cleaning services in Cincinnati are priced per square foot per month, but the slab and the offices are costed separately because they are different jobs. Open warehouse floor is cheap per square foot and expensive per hour of machine time; welfare areas are the reverse. A quote that gives one blended rate for a 90,000 square foot building has not looked at it properly.

Ask a bidder how many machine hours are in the price, not just the monthly figure. Manufacturing facility cleaning quoted without machine time is quoted on a broom, and a broom on a 90,000 square foot slab moves dust around rather than removing it.

How we hold quality on warehouse cleaning services in Cincinnati, OH

The first thing we agree is the window. Commercial warehouse cleaning goes wrong when a crew is asked to work a live aisle, so the scope names the hours, the doors we use, and who holds the keys. If your shift pattern changes, the schedule changes with it rather than the crew improvising.

After that it is the usual discipline: one crew assigned to your building, a written scope before the first visit, and a photo-verified checklist filed afterwards. On an industrial site that record matters more than most, because the thing an auditor asks about is almost never last night — it is the third week of last quarter.

Floor condition is a safety duty before it is a housekeeping one, and the expectations are set out in OSHA’s walking-working surfaces standard. Airborne dust is the other half of the problem — the EPA’s indoor air quality guidance explains why dry-sweeping a slab makes it worse, which is why we scrub rather than sweep wherever a machine will fit.
